  4. ES U8 Daily Chart June / 18 / 2008


    Daily ES bar made a LL and a LH on increasing dominant volume.

    A point 3 traverse in the dominant direction of the trend was recognized at bar end yesterday, and needed more increasing volume to follow today.

    Dominant volume today increased by 369,230 more than previous day.

    Although price formed a LL and a LH on dominant volume following a point 3, price still closed within the lateral movement 1.75 point short of b/o.


    Daily bar range today = 21 points

    Close of daily bar = 20% of the range on dominant volume.
